Q2 Planning Note — Ardelune Instruments

Board: sole reliance on Virek Castings for sensor housings is an unacceptable risk after their fire last quarter. Procurement has shortlisted two alternates, one in Molvany, one domestic. Qualification runs start within six weeks; dual-sourcing target is 40/60 by Q4. Unit cost rises roughly 3% short-term. Recommendation: approve qualification budget as presented. The confidential strategic note follows below.

internal memo for kawip-hadug: Headcount on the Wenwyn team goes from 7 to 140 by the end of January. Gross margin on Wenwyn came in at 20 percent against a plan of 15 percent.

Runbook — replacement server, Bracken Hill branch. The unit from Torvane Systems is palletised in bay 6, shock sensors attached. Keep it upright — the rails shift if it's tipped. Courier pick-up is slotted for 10:00; don't release it early even if they push. The confidential hand-over instruction for the courier sits just below.

handover note for yagef-bagep: the drudor pelius courier leaves the kasdor zorvan norir ledger at gate 8016 under passcode 755406

Ticket #6642 — Transcode vault locked again

Hey on-call — the Shredmill vault that holds license keys for the Bramblecast transcoding farm sealed itself mid-shift, so all the render nodes are idling. Jobs are piling up in the queue. Unseal it from the farm controller box; it'll prompt you, and the current recovery passphrase is below.

unlock words, hahip-baduf: holwyn-istath-julvan

**Leadership Review Briefing — Closing the Marbury Lane Office**

Quick heads-up for department heads: we're winding down the Marbury Lane site by year end. Staff will shift to remote or the Fennick Row hub. Lease exit costs are manageable, and Orla Devane is handling the logistics. The sensitive piece of the plan is noted just below.

confidential, kagep-kahof: Druokax Systems plans to lower the Ulaath list price by 53 percent in March.

Welcome to the team. Last Thursday we ran a disaster-recovery drill on the Glimmerfind autocomplete index, which had been serving suggestions at roughly four-second latencies. We rebuilt the index from the snapshot store in the Ferrow region; total recovery took forty minutes, mostly spent re-warming the shard caches. Key takeaway for newcomers: the snapshot store is encrypted, and the rebuild script will pause and wait for an operator. At that prompt, enter the recovery passphrase shown below.

vault phrase of bagaf-kajeg = jorath-feniel-briir-siliel-ralix